FineUI 官方论坛

 找回密码
 立即注册

QQ登录

只需一步,快速开始

本论坛已关闭(禁止注册、发帖和回复)
请移步 三石和他的朋友们

FineUI首页 WebForms - MVC & Core - JavaScript 常见问题 - QQ群 - 十周年征文活动

FineUI(开源版) 下载源代码 - 下载空项目 - 获取ExtJS - 文档 在线示例 - 版本更新 - 捐赠作者 - 教程

升级到 ASP.NET Core 3.1,快、快、快! 全新ASP.NET Core,比WebForms还简单! 欢迎加入【三石和他的朋友们】(基础版下载)

搜索
查看: 4772|回复: 5
打印 上一主题 下一主题

TextArea控件的Required属性BUG,版本3.01

[复制链接]
跳转到指定楼层
楼主
发表于 2012-2-21 10:57:53 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 hudingwen 于 2012-2-21 11:00 编辑

使用TextArea控件时,只要使用了Required=“true”属性,那么在控件中输入了标点符号,如逗号,句号等等时,就会报500错误

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
沙发
发表于 2012-2-26 21:38:25 | 只看该作者
没有遇到这个问题哦,能不能写一个简单的测试页面来。。。
板凳
发表于 2012-3-1 20:47:03 | 只看该作者
我这里就算不是 Required=“true” ,而内容有包含 <>等符号都报这个错。。
地板
发表于 2012-3-1 21:57:05 | 只看该作者
啥浏览器,写个测试页面
5#
发表于 2012-3-9 10:25:41 | 只看该作者
如果允许用户提交<>等HTML代码,需要页面的Page声明中加上ValidateRequest="false"
<%@ Page Language="c#" AutoEventWireup="true" CodeBehind="AfficheSave.aspx.cs" Inherits="OA.WebSite.Manage.AfficheSave" ValidateRequest="false" %>

如果是.NET 4.0,还需要配置web.config

  <system.web>
      <httpRuntime requestValidationMode="2.0" />
</system.web>
6#
发表于 2012-3-9 10:29:04 | 只看该作者
本帖最后由 杜志彬 于 2012-3-9 13:06 编辑

建议三生石上在弹出提示框时,能够把页面的错误提示信息都显示出来,非常有助于代码调试。现在这样只能显示一个信息的标题头,大家排除BUG时有点摸不着头脑。如果把错误信息都显示出来,大家顺藤摸瓜就可以了哈。

我曾经有一次,在登录时提示500错误,调试了半天才发现是数据库没有启动。如果在看到传统的ASP.NET页面错误信息后,就可以马上定位到错误原因。
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|FineUI 官方论坛 ( 皖ICP备2021006167号-1 )

GMT+8, 2024-11-24 09:50 , Processed in 0.045389 second(s), 19 queries , Gzip On.

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表